Output 31edfdd25ea8e8f6f22240092a8c7a4466d2fc39215314872d21e5b6263d900c:3

value
686487120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d55c047c95d21846bdd4fd9aef2ddeabe8ed4fa OP_EQUAL
address
MScsUr297j3ebSDRHquf6AGhnSxZpRBPr8
transaction
31edfdd25ea8e8f6f22240092a8c7a4466d2fc39215314872d21e5b6263d900c
spent
true